People may debate which Super Dish ad was the very best, yet there’s no question which was the most consequential– and not in such a way the brand desired.
The Ring advertisement “Search Celebration” ran in the third quarter of the video game, and it’s easy to understand why somebody thought it was a good idea: It’s about locating lost canines. That isn’t for that? As a whole? Virtually nobody. In this details case? A great deal of people. Since it was especially regarding utilizing Ring’s networked, AI-enabled cameras to locate lost pet dogs.
There was a giant detach between what the advertisement showed and what individuals understood it to show. Clearly, executives at Ring (an Amazon subsidiary) thought that pictures of a canine being tracked from residence to residence would certainly offer consumers cozy fuzzies. In reality, it gave them the willies since they saw a mass security gadget in action.

The advertisement performed in 30 secs what security and civil rights professionals had actually been trying to do for many years: Enlighten the general public regarding the genuine issue with Ring. And the general public responded rapidly. Here are some headings from the next day:
That occurred since the only individuals who believed the advertisement got on Ring’s pay-roll. As WeRateDogs’ Matt Nelson claimed in a video that rapidly went viral:
“Neither Ring’s items nor organization model are developed around discovering lost family pets, but instead producing a profitable mass surveillance network by turning personal homes into security stations and well-meaning neighbors into informants for ICE and other federal government companies.”
( WeRateDogs started as a popular social media account humorously “ranking” dogs and has since grown into a revered charity that funds vet treatment. Nelson has actually developed a large, faithful following– and lugs actual trustworthiness with that audience.)

Nelson likewise indicated Ring’s partnership with the personal monitoring company Flock Security. Via that integration, Ring footage could be accessed by law enforcement by means of a community-request system that did not call for a standard warrant. Information acquired via those channels has been shown government firms, consisting of ICE, the FBI and the Navy.
That partnership finished last Friday, when” Amazon’s Ring terminates Flock collaboration amid Super Bowl ad backlash.”
What marketing professionals require to recognize
Smart brands face their reputational luggage directly or develop around it. BMW recognized its polarizing photo and repositioned Mini as the antidote. Ring did the opposite– it constructed a feel-good narrative around the really capacity that fuels public discomfort.
In an AI-powered globe, you can not reframe danger with sentimentality. If the public sees monitoring, no amount of lost pups will transform the lens.
